    Monday 7.13.09
    Dulgheru +240 (Suarez-Navarro)
    A mostly unknown, but rapid ranking riser in the Romanian Alexandra Dulgheru against another young up & comer in Suarez-Navarro. Dulgheru has impressively risen from a ranking of 385 at the end of 2008 to her current rank of 75. She showed her promise by wining the Warsaw clay event in May. That came on the heels of a ton of success at the lower level, getting to a pair of finals in a row in April (winning one). The big question here is can she maintain her success against higher ranked players? Beating Alona Bondarenko in the Warsaw final was her top scalp (#39 at the time). Navarro is currently ranked in the low 30s. Navarro has been up & down on clay this season. She had troubles with her health early in the season and results-wise. Then she went on a nice run in April when she made the finals & semis of consecutive dirt court tourneys. After that, it's been mixed again. Her serve continues to drag her down as it is definitely not a strength. These two players are similar stats-wise in that they both do more on the return than they do on serve.

    Not a big play, but for small stakes with no dominant serve - could have a shot.
